In accordance with India’s 75th Independence anniversary, Britain has declared to partner with leading businesses in India and UK offers 75 scholarships for Indian students to pursue education in the UK universities from the month of September.

This offer includes programs like Chevening scholarships, a one-year master’s degree with the opportunity to choose any subject from any recognized UK university. In addition to that, the British Council of India is offering around 18 scholarships for women in the fields of ST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ics), which encompasses over 12,000 courses at 150+ UK universities.

Hence, female candidates from India who are looking to pursue a master’s degree or early academic fellowship in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) can benefit from this opportunity by applying for one of the 18 scholarships offered by the British Council of India.

This fully-funded scholarship includes tuition, living expenses, and travel costs for a one-year post-graduate program. 

HSBC, Pearson India, Hindustan Unilever, Tata Sons, and Duolingo are contributing to this exceptional initiative. HSBC will sponsor 15 scholarships, Pearson will sponsor 2, Hindustan Unilever, Tata Sons, and Duolingo will sponsor one each as part of the 75 scholarships.

Premier Boris Johnson welcomed ‘India/UK Together’ during his recent visit to India, promoting both countries’ rich cultural ties.

The education system is regarded as the “living bridge between the UK and India that connects our people through common values and affinities.”  Over 108,000 study visas were issued to Indian nationals in the year ending March 2022, which is almost double the previous year.
